Simplify square root of 27

Problem

√(,27)

Solution

  1. Identify the radicand and look for the largest perfect square factor of 27

  2. Factor the number 27 into the product of a perfect square and another integer.

√(,27)=√(,9⋅3)

  1. Apply the product property of square roots, which states √(,a⋅b)=√(,a)⋅√(,b)

√(,9⋅3)=√(,9)⋅√(,3)

  1. Simplify the square root of the perfect square 9

√(,9)⋅√(,3)=3√(,3)

Final Answer

√(,27)=3√(,3)
